Examples:

The difference between the two supplementary angles is 42°.Find both angles.

Step 1a

The sum of two supplementary angles is equal to 180°.

1a

.

Explanation: When two angles are supplementary, their sum equals 180°.

Step 1b

Let us assume one angle is (180 - x)° and second angle be x°.

Explanation: Let’s assume that one angle measures (180 - x)° and the other angle measures x°.

Step 1c

The given text highlights a difference., 42°

Therefore (180 - x)° - x ° = 42°

After simplification 180° - 2x = 42°

⇒ 180° - 42° = 2x

⇒ 2x = 138°

Then x value is 69°

The second angle is 180° - 69° = 111°

Explanation: To find two angles when one angle is 42° more than the other, we can use the equation 180° - 2x = 42°. After simplification, we get x = 69° and the larger angle is 111°.

Step 1d

So, the two supplementary angles are:

Angle A = 69°

Angle B = 111°

Explanation: So we’ve got two angles here that add up to 180°. The first one measures 69°, and the second one is 111°.
